Virginia Doughty 1925-2026
At the age of 100, "Aunt Granny" stepped across into the arms of her Savior, Jesus. She was born to Harriet (Draper) (Miller) Snover and Lester Miller in Cortland, NY. During WWII she worked for the Aircraft Warning Service. She was posted on top of Virgil Hill as a "Plane Spotter." She retired from Pall-Trinity in Cortland in 1990. She was a founding member of the New Hope Bible Fellowship Church where her macaroni & cheese and caramel corn were legendary.
